Output 95b5999ada5b60ab3baba6ceba85151d35de92bd23fc128188583ea93e7b2afa:1
- value
- 2820185539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4a2bc6af0380e7c08b112779bf243579be84d32 OP_EQUAL
- address
- 3KcjKEnYFwpppShZDamCQUNWCHHRnBL2j1
- transaction
- 95b5999ada5b60ab3baba6ceba85151d35de92bd23fc128188583ea93e7b2afa
- confirmations
- 219210
- spent
- true